Dear NRC:
g ~ As a pennsylvania resident who i s downwind from Three Mile Island, I strongly protest tr e decision by the Atomic Safety and L.icensing Board whicn recommends that i4etropolitan Edison Co. be allowed to restart reactor ho. 1 at 1MI. I believe tnere are many reasons wny restart o,t TML-1 should not be permitted at this time: _ A method of paying for the cledn-up of TH1-2 nas not even been agreed to dno the clean-up itselt has hardly begun. The clean-up is an entirely new process, and who Kno'*s what proolems may arise. I believe the cledn-up of TMI-2 should be substantially complete Detore anot.ner reactor -- TM1-1 is dllowed to oDerate on the sale site. _ The invest.19dtion of cnedting on qualification tests by reactor operators at IMI has not Deen completed. Certainly this should be entirely cleared up betore any reactor is allowed to operate at INI. ~ _ 1he courts riaVe not had a chance to rule on the issue of the psychological stress whicn a restart would cause tor residents in the.immediate Vicinity of 1MI. They haVe a right to be heard before Met-Ed and t he httC. p r e-emp t their case. _ An. adequate evacuation plan for tne LNT1RE hazdro ~ drea around TMI nas yet to be prepared and accepted. this must include at least a 25.n11e rodius. I airo reject the ASLB contention tnat Met-Ed and GPU Nuclear are Qua11 tied to operate.a nUCledr reactor. They told ~ us tne accident couldn't nappen, then covered it up wnile it .as nappening. And now we're. supposed to believe them when they sdy it Won't hdppen dQaln? I urue the Nuclear Reguldtory Commission to reject the ASLO recommendation. Please order tnat IMl-1 remain closed until ALL of the above proolems are resolved. 6 69 Sincerely, G<a 0-a&s , a a. w n.,6 cM der, b I { iem s ___}}
